Weanie Beans: Mexico, Tlecuaxco Group, Washed

Tasting notes: Tastes of hot fudge and pecan pie, this coffee has a little orange finish to cut through the sweetness

From Weanie Beans:

The Tlecuaxco Group is made up of 6 neighbouring farms on the Zongolica mountain range. They each only use organic compost as fertiliser to grow the Bourbon, Caturra & Garnica varieties, which are grown amongst native shade trees and plants, providing a safe haven for birds and other wildlife.

The coffee cherries are pulped at the group's wet mill and dried on raised beds, which helps to give the coffee a smooth and buttery mouthfeel.

Farm/Coop: Tlecuaxco Group
Origin: Mexico, Central America
Region: Zongolica Mountain Range
Process Method: Washed Process
Varietals: Bourbon, Caturra & Garnica
